Ever wonder how a by-product of beer gave us Vegemite, an Australian icon? Have you heard about the bakers producing pide, damper or Johnny cakes from ancient Middle Eastern or Indigenous grains? Did you know our roads and buildings used to be constructed from oysters? Or that soybeans can be transformed into plastic and cars?  

To find out about all these things and much more, join Lee Tran Lam and Australian chefs, business owners, researchers and growers on The Culinary Archive Podcast, a six-part series by the Powerhouse exploring Australia’s foodways.
